在人工智能飞速发展的今天,大模型(Large Language Model,LLM)已经成为了各个行业不可或缺的工具。从自然语言处理到代码生成,从数据分析到创意写作,大模型的应用场景越来越广泛。然而,面对市场上琳琅满目的AI助手,如何挑选适合自己需求的大模型呢?本文将为你提供一份详细的选型指南。
了解你的需求
在挑选大模型之前,首先要明确自己的需求。以下是一些常见的使用场景:
- 自然语言处理:文本生成、机器翻译、情感分析等。
- 代码生成:自动生成代码、代码补全、代码审查等。
- 数据分析:数据可视化、数据摘要、数据挖掘等。
- 创意写作:小说创作、诗歌生成、剧本编写等。
明确需求后,你可以根据以下因素进行选型:
1. 模型性能
- 准确率:模型在特定任务上的表现,如文本生成、翻译等。
- 速度:模型处理任务的效率,对于实时性要求高的场景尤为重要。
- 泛化能力:模型在不同数据集上的表现,是否能够适应新的任务。
2. 模型规模
- 参数量:模型参数的数量,参数量越大,模型通常越强大。
- 训练数据量:模型训练所使用的数据量,数据量越大,模型通常越准确。
3. 模型易用性
- API接口:模型是否提供API接口,方便开发者调用。
- 文档支持:模型是否提供详细的文档,帮助开发者快速上手。
- 社区支持:模型是否有活跃的社区,方便开发者交流和学习。
4. 模型成本
- 购买成本:模型购买的价格,包括一次性购买和按需付费。
- 使用成本:模型使用过程中的费用,如API调用费用、存储费用等。
5. 模型安全性
- 数据隐私:模型在处理数据时是否能够保护用户隐私。
- 模型安全:模型是否容易受到攻击,如对抗样本攻击等。
6. 模型定制化
- 定制化能力:模型是否支持定制化,如调整参数、修改模型结构等。
案例分析
以下是一些常见的大模型及其特点:
- GPT-3:由OpenAI开发的自然语言处理模型,参数量达到1750亿,在多个自然语言处理任务上表现出色。
- BERT:由Google开发的预训练语言模型,在多个自然语言处理任务上取得了优异的成绩。
- Turing NLG:由Hugging Face开发的自然语言生成模型,支持多种语言和任务。
- CodeX:由微软开发的代码生成模型,能够自动生成代码、代码补全、代码审查等。
总结
挑选适合自己需求的大模型需要综合考虑多个因素,包括模型性能、规模、易用性、成本、安全性和定制化能力等。通过了解自己的需求,对比不同模型的优缺点,你可以找到最适合自己的人工智能助手。
